@import "tailwindcss/theme";
@import "../variables/theme.css";

.partnerCard {
  @apply grid;

  gap: var(--spacing-24);
}

.partnerCard-visual {
  @apply aspect-video;
}

.partnerCard-information {
}

.partnerCard-title {
  font: var(--h3-serif);
  font-size: var(--text-heading-sm-md);
  line-height: var(--leading-heading-sm-md);

  @variant md {
    font-size: var(--text-heading-md-md);
    line-height: var(--leading-heading-md-md);
  }

  @variant lg {
    font-size: var(--text-heading-lg-md);
    line-height: var(--leading-heading-lg-md);
  }
}

.partnerCard-description {
  @apply text-neutral-800;

  margin-top: var(--spacing-16);
  font: var(--t3-medium);
}

.partnerCard-action {
  width: 100%;

  @variant lg {
    width: fit-content;
  }
}
